package impl
Type Members
-
final
case class
ChronoLocalDateOps(underlying: ChronoLocalDate) extends AnyVal with Product with Serializable
Enriches a ChronoLocalDate with additional methods.
-
final
case class
ChronoLocalDateTimeOps[A <: ChronoLocalDate](underlying: ChronoLocalDateTime[A]) extends AnyVal with Product with Serializable
Enriches a ChronoLocalDateTime with additional methods.
-
final
case class
ChronoZonedDateTimeOps[A <: ChronoLocalDate](underlying: ChronoZonedDateTime[A]) extends AnyVal with Product with Serializable
Enriches a ChronoZonedDateTime with additional methods.
-
final
case class
DurationOps(underlying: Duration) extends AnyVal with Product with Serializable
Enriches a Duration with scala friendly methods.
-
final
case class
IntOps(underlying: Int) extends AnyVal with Product with Serializable
Enriches a scala.Long with methods for obtaining Period instances.
-
final
case class
LongOps(underlying: Long) extends AnyVal with Product with Serializable
Enriches a scala.Int with methods for obtaining Duration instances.
-
final
case class
MonthDayOps(underlying: MonthDay) extends AnyVal with Product with Serializable
Enriches MonthDay instances with additional methods.
-
final
case class
MonthOps(underlying: Month) extends AnyVal with Product with Serializable
Enriches a Month with additional methods.
-
final
case class
PeriodOps(underlying: Period) extends AnyVal with Product with Serializable
Enriches a Period with scala friendly methods.
- final case class StringOps(underlying: String) extends AnyVal with Product with Serializable
-
final
case class
TemporalAccessorOps(underlying: TemporalAccessor) extends AnyVal with Product with Serializable
Enriches a TemporalAccessor with additional methods.
-
final
case class
TemporalAdjusterOps(underlying: TemporalAdjuster) extends AnyVal with Product with Serializable
Enriches a TemporalAdjuster with additional methods.
-
final
case class
TemporalAmountOps(underlying: TemporalAmount) extends AnyVal with Product with Serializable
Enriches a TemporalAmount with scala friendly methods.
-
final
case class
TemporalOps(underlying: Temporal) extends AnyVal with Product with Serializable
Enriches a Temporal with additional methods.
-
final
case class
TemporalQueryOps[A](underlying: TemporalQuery[A]) extends AnyVal with Product with Serializable
Enriches instances of TemporalQuery with additional methods.
-
final
case class
TemporalUnitOps(underlying: TemporalUnit) extends Product with Serializable
Enriches TemporalUnit with additional methods.
- abstract class ToAllOps extends ToIntOps with ToLongOps with ToMonthDayOps with ToMonthOps with ToTemporalAccessorOps with ToTemporalAdjusterOps with ToTemporalAmountOps with ToDurationOps with ToPeriodOps with ToTemporalOps with ToTemporalQueryOps with ToTemporalUnitOps with ToYearMonthOps with ToYearOps with ToChronoLocalDateOps with ToChronoLocalDateTimeOps with ToChronoZonedDateTimeOps with ToStringOps
- trait ToAllStd extends ToTemporalQuery
- trait ToChronoLocalDateOps extends AnyRef
- trait ToChronoLocalDateTimeOps extends AnyRef
- trait ToChronoZonedDateTimeOps extends AnyRef
- trait ToDurationOps extends Any
- trait ToIntOps extends Any
- trait ToLongOps extends Any
- trait ToMonthDayOps extends Any
- trait ToMonthOps extends Any
- trait ToPeriodOps extends Any
- trait ToStringOps extends AnyRef
- trait ToTemporalAccessorOps extends Any
- trait ToTemporalAdjusterOps extends Any
- trait ToTemporalAmountOps extends Any
- trait ToTemporalOps extends Any
- trait ToTemporalQuery extends Any
- trait ToTemporalQueryOps extends Any
- trait ToTemporalUnitOps extends Any
- trait ToYearMonthOps extends Any
- trait ToYearOps extends Any
-
final
case class
YearMonthOps(underlying: YearMonth) extends AnyVal with Product with Serializable
Enriches YearMonth instances with additional methods.
-
final
case class
YearOps(underlying: Year) extends AnyVal with Product with Serializable
Enriches Year instances with additional methods.
Scala Time
scala-time is a simple Scala wrapper for easier use JDK 1.8.0 (Java 8) time APIs
Overview
The library is contained in the scalatime package which includes extension methods provided via implicit conversion methods to Scala value classes.
For usage examples see below: